#f3c99a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f3c99a is composed of 95.3% red, 78.8% green and 60.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.3% magenta, 36.6%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 31.7 degrees, a saturation of 78.8% and a lightness of 77.8%. #f3c99a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e79335.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

Shades and Tints of #f3c99a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040200 is the darkest color, while #fdf8f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f3c99a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c8c7c5 is the less saturated color, while #fcc991 is the most saturated one.
